Hi,

We made customs board with K64 for our product.

At some boards, I couldn't connect to the MCU by the Multilink Universal. (some boards were OK)

I have asked this issue already, please see following post.

Reset signal of K64

Finally, I replaced the MCU on my custom board to new one, then I could connect to the MCU.

I think I have to know why this issue happened.

So I would like NXP to check and verify my removed MCU.

MCU is broken or not,

MCU is in the specific mode,

etc...

How can I order this?

If someone has information, please let me know.

Hi Kiyoshi Matsuzaki,

    Thank you for your more details.

    If you solder the chip on the board by your hand, and you didn't care about the solder temperature, I think your chip maybe damaged to a large degree.

   A lot of people may damage the chip when they solder the chip and never care about the temperature.

   When you solder the chip by hand, take care of 2 points:

1. solder temperature below 260°C

2. solder time should as short as possible, long chip solder time may also damage the chip.

If you can't mass erase the chip and can't find the core, I suggest to solder an new chip and try again.

Hi Kiyoshi Matsuzaki,

    From your description, your chip may be locked or broken, there has a lot of factors may caused this phenomena.

1. solid problem

   The solid temperature should not higher than 260°C, you can find this from the kinetis datasheet.

    the solid time should as short as possible, both the higher temperature and the long solid time may damage the chip.

93.jpg

2. power on sequence

  If you power on the reset pin before the VDD, this will cause the chip be locked. You should make sure the VDD is power on at first, then the reset pin can be power on again.

3. the debug interface wire is too long.

The debug wire between the board and the debugger should not longer than 15cm.

4, power and debug signal is not stable

Normally, if you find the chip can't be connect, please use the JLINK associate with the JLINK COMMANDER to unlock the chip at first, if the chip is locked, then it can be unlocked through the mass erase, but if the chip is damaged, it won't be connect with the debugger or programmer again.

Besides, we also recommend you add an 4.7K to 10K pullup resistor in the SWD_DIO and the NMI pin.
